#footer {
	text-align:center;
}

#footer .footer_content {
	padding-top:25px;
	margin:0 auto;
	width:970px;
	text-align:center;
	font-family:"Times New Roman",Times,serif;
	font-size:10pt;
}

#footer .footer_content a {
	text-align:center;
	color:#FFFFFF;
}

/* twitter */

#wt_twitter_newsticker {
}

.wttwitter_feed {
	list-style-type:none;
	margin:0;
	margin-bottom:40px;
	padding:0;
}

.wttwitter_feed li {
	margin-bottom:15px;
}

.wttwitter_feed div.twitter_date {
	font-size:7pt;
	font-style:italic;
}

.wttwitter_feed .twitter_text {
	    font-size: 9pt;
    line-height: 14pt;
}

.wttwitter_feed .twitter_text a {
	color:#BB8800;
}

/* TT_NEWS */

.news_list {
	margin-bottom:25px;
}

.news_list p {
	margin:0;
	padding:0;
}

.news_list a {
	color:#b0b0b0;
	text-decoration:none;
}

.news_list .news_date {
	margin:0;
	padding:0;
	font-weight:bold;
}

.news_list .news_title {
	margin:0;
	padding:0;
	font-weight:bold;
	margin-bottom:5px;
	line-height:auto;
	height:auto;
}

.news_list .news_text,
.news_list .news_text p.bodytext {
	margin:0;
	padding:0;
	line-height:13pt;
	height:auto;
}

/* Books Frame */

#frame_books {
	background-image:url(../images/frame_books.png);
	position:absolute;
	bottom:105px;
	left:105px;
	padding:10px 15px 0 45px;
	height:67px;
	_height:77px;
	width:423px;
	_width:483px;
}

#frame_books .book {
	float:left;
	margin-right:35px;
}

#frame_books a img {
	border:0 none;
}

/* login */

div.tx-felogin-pi1 {
	float:right;
	margin-right:25px;
	margin-top:5px;
}

fieldset.login {
	border:none;
}

fieldset.login label {
	float:left;
	width:100px;
	color:#C4C4C4;
	font-size:8pt;
}

div.forgot_pass {
	float:left;
	margin-top:5px;
	width:150px;
}

div.login_button {
	margin-top:8px;
}

.forgot_pass a {
	color:#C4C4C4;
	font-size:8pt;
}

.login_input {
	margin-bottom:5px;
}

/* gallery */

.tx-chgallery-pi1 .singleimg {
	text-align:center;
	float:left;
	padding:0 0;
	margin:9px 0;
	position:relative;
	width:214px;
	height:199px;
}

.tx-chgallery-pi1 .singleimg {
	text-align:center;
	float:left;
	padding:0 0;
	margin:9px 0;
	position:relative;
	width:214px;
	height:199px;
}

.singleimg_startpage {
	text-align:center;
	float:left;
	width:88px;
	height:62px;	
}


/* Pagebrowser */
.tx-chgallery-pi1 .pagebrowser {
	padding:3px 0;	
	margin:25px 0;
}

.tx-chgallery-pi1 .pagebrowser .prev {
	width:20%;
	float:left;
}

.tx-chgallery-pi1 .pagebrowser .text {
	width:60%;
	float:left;
	text-align:center;
}

.tx-chgallery-pi1 .pagebrowser .next {
	width:20%;
	float:right;
	text-align:right;
}

/* box */

.box_left {
	width:200px;
	float:left;
	position:relative;
}

.box_right_large {
	width:446px;
	float:right;
}

/* register button */

#specialbar .bodytext {
	margin:0;
}

/* lightbox */

#shadowbox {
/*	background-color:#000000; */
}

#shadowbox_title {
	position:relative;

}

.shadowbox_title_left {
	background-image:url(../images/lightbox/lightbox_t_l.png);
	background-repeat:no-repeat;
	position:absolute;
	left:-10px;
	top:0;
	height:37px;
	width:31px;
	z-index:100;
}

.shadowbox_title_right {
	background-image:url(../images/lightbox/lightbox_t_r.png);
	background-repeat:no-repeat;
	position:absolute;
	right:-8px;
	top:0;
	height:37px;
	width:31px;
	z-index:100;
}

.shadowbox_toolbar_right {
	background-image:url(../images/lightbox/lightbox_b_r.png);
	background-repeat:no-repeat;
	position:absolute;
	right:-20px;
	bottom:10px;
	height:37px;
	width:31px;
	z-index:100;
}


.shadowbox_toolbar_left {
	background-image:url(../images/lightbox/lightbox_b_l.png);
	background-repeat:no-repeat;
	position:absolute;
	left:-10px;
	bottom:10px;
	height:37px;
	width:31px;
	z-index:100;
}

#shadowbox_title_inner {
	background-image:url(../images/lightbox/lightbox_t.png);
	background-repeat:repeat-x;
	height:37px;
	position:relative;
	z-index:100;
	margin:0 23px 0 21px;
}

#shadowbox_title_inner img {
	position:absolute;
	z-index:-1;
}

#shadowbox_body .shadowbox_left {
	background-image:url(../images/lightbox/lightbox_l.png);
	background-repeat:repeat-y;
	width:19px;
	height:100%;
	position:absolute;
	left:-10px;
	z-index:100;
}

#shadowbox_body .shadowbox_right {
	background-image:url(../images/lightbox/lightbox_r.png);
	background-repeat:repeat-y;
	width:19px;
	height:100%;
	position:absolute;
	right:-10px;
	z-index:100;
}

#shadowbox_toolbar {
	background-image:url(../images/lightbox/lightbox_b.png);
	background-repeat:repeat-x;
	height:47px;
}

#shadowbox_nav_close {
	position:absolute;
	right:25px;
	top:-14px;
	z-index:101;
}

#shadowbox_toolbar_inner {

}

#shadowbox_nav_previous  {

	left:-4px;
	position:absolute;
	z-index:501;
}

#shadowbox_counter {
	margin-top:14px;
	left:50px;
	position:absolute;
}

#shadowbox_nav_next {
	right:-14px;
	position:absolute;
	z-index:501;
}

/* shoutbox */

#largecontent .tx-simpleshoutbox-pi1 {
	width:800px;
	margin:25px auto;
}

.tx-simpleshoutbox-pi1 .tx-simpleshoutbox-list  {
	height:150px;
	background-image:url(../images/background_grey.jpg);
	border:1px solid #999999;
}

.tx-simpleshoutbox-pi1 .tx-simpleshoutbox-list .tx-simpleshoutbox-message {
	background-color:#AAA8A8;
	background-image:url(../img/forum_bar_bg.gif);
	background-repeat:repeat-x;
	border:1px solid #FFFFFF;
}

.tx-simpleshoutbox-pi1 .tx-simpleshoutbox-list .tx-simpleshoutbox-message .tx-simpleshoutbox-message-header {
	background:none;
}
